Indonesia's Dukono and Semeru Volcanoes Erupt on July 15, 2026

Two Indonesian volcanoes erupted on July 15, 2026. In Maluku Utara, Mount Dukono sent an ash column up to 2.3 km high and remained active, prompting the volcanology agency to keep the volcano at Alert Level II and advise residents and visitors to stay at least 4 km away and wear masks.

In East Java, Mount Semeru produced an ash plume about 1.2 km high, causing thin ash rain in Lumajang Regency. The mountain stayed at Alert Level III, with authorities warning of possible pyroclastic flows, lava, and lahar, and recommending people avoid the summit area and wear protective masks.

Both eruptions were recorded by seismographs, showing significant amplitude and duration, and underline ongoing volcanic hazards in Indonesia.
